- The distance between Diamantino, Brazil and Red Deer, Ab, Canada is approximately 9,221 km or 5,730 mi.
- To reach Diamantino in this distance one would set out from Red Deer, Ab bearing 124.6° or SE and follow the great circles arc to approach Diamantino bearing 148.6° or SSE .
- Diamantino has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Red Deer, Ab has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
- Diamantino is in or near the tropical dry forest biome whereas Red Deer, Ab is in or near the boreal moist forest biome.
- The average temperature is 22.9 °C (41.2°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 25.6 °C (46.1°F) less in Diamantino.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1149.6 mm (45.3 in) more which is equivalent to 1149.6 l/m² (28.21 US gal/ft²) or 11,496,000 l/ha (1,228,999 US gal/ac) more. About 3 4/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 33.4° higher in Diamantino than in Red Deer, Ab.
